Dani Zelko

Daniel Zelko is an Argentine artist born in 1990 whose work blends literature, politics, and language experimentation. Since 2015, he has led Reunión, a publishing and gathering project co-produced with Museo Reina Sofía, Fundación Proa, and Palais de Glace. He has taught workshops at the National University of the Arts and NYU and has presented his work at Princeton, the University of Pennsylvania, and Museo Tamayo. He has published poetry collections and music albums and translated works by Frank O’Hara and Angela Davis. In 2023, he was named Distinguished Latin American Writer at the University of California, Berkeley.
